Angelique

Angelique is a patient who has been around the ship since the fall, when she had the first of her surgeries.


You can see from this picture just how thin she is.  Patients with these large facial tumors are very isolated.
Many have given up hope of ever being normal. They need spiritual healing as well as physical healing.
We have a great team of chaplains in the hospital who work with the patients.  We know that God is in charge of their healing.
Angelique seeing herself after surgery



As she heals, her skin will eventually shrink to fit her face.  Dr Parker has pioneered this type of surgery and teaches his techniques to other surgeons.  Angelique has been staying at the Hope Center between surgeries.  Today she had her fifth surgery, and we gave her a unit of blood.  She has received a total of eleven units of blood as a result of all those surgeries.
